Denso Reman Starter for Honda S2000
The Denso Reman Starter 280-0316 is a 12-volt, clockwise-rotation starter built for direct replacement on select Honda S2000 applications. It combines remanufactured OE engineering with updated wear components to support reliable cranking performance in daily driving and temperature swings.
Key Features
- 12.0V starter with clockwise rotation
- 1.0 kW power rating for OE-style starting performance
- Remanufactured DENSO OE family starter
- High-voltage tested armature and field coils
- Refinished commutators and replaced copper terminals and fasteners
- New bearings, brushes, and seals

Installation Notes and Tips
Verify the vehicle’s original starter specifications before installation, including 12-volt system requirements and clockwise rotation. Confirm fitment against the Honda S2000 model year and compare the existing unit to the Denso 280-0316 before removal. Clean battery cable ends and starter mounting surfaces to help ensure a solid electrical and mechanical connection.
Quality Assurance
DENSO remanufactured starters are bench-tested after remanufacturing to verify factory-original performance. The reman process includes testing of armatures and field coils, replacement of wear items such as bearings, brushes, and seals, and use of copper electrical components where required for dependable current flow.
